Backdrop
2018 Documentary

Sur les traces de la panthère des neiges

In a secret valley in the Tibetan highlands, lives a mythical, rare and fascinating animal: the snow leopard. Frédéric and Olivier Larrey, two brothers and naturalist photographers, set out on their trail.

8.0 TMDB RATING
WATCH MOVIE

You Might Also Like